Blake Shelton, Trace Adkins take “Hillbilly Bone” to No. 1

Oklahoma country music star Blake Shelton has taken “Hillbilly Bone,” his raucous duet with fellow star Trace Adkins, to the top of the Billboard Hot Country Songs and Country Aircheck (Mediabase) charts.

It becomes Shelton’s sixth No. 1 single. It also is nominated for vocal event of the year honors at the Academy of Country Music Awards, which will be handed out April 18 in Las Vegas.

“Hillbilly Bone” is the lead-off single to Shelton’s new album, which recently debuted at No. 2 on the Billboard Hot Country Albums list. It also became Shelton’s highest album debut on Billboard’s Top 200 chart to date, coming in at No. 3.

Shelton, an Ada native who now lives in Tishomingo, will celebrate his latest hit tonight as he plays his first headlining show at Nashville’s historic Ryman Auditorium. Appropriately enough, the show is a sell-out.
